Stopped by time
A poem inspired by this image.
Still a work in progress, any feedback more then welcome.
For many years,
Man tinkered and played,
So I could keep on going.
Every day I continuously ran,
Without a reason or rhyme.
But they were times long ago,
When I was of use to man,
And he was of use to me.
Wasn’t till I was left alone,
That I was stopped by time.
